操作系统作为计算机的核心组件,其进程管理功能至关重要。尤其是在多任务环境中,后台程序的有效管理直接影响系统性能与用户体验。后台程序通常是指那些在用户界面外运行的应用,比如定时备份、更新下载等。这些程序在不干扰用户操作的也占用系统资源。理解如何有效管理这些后台进程,已成为提升系统性能和稳定性的重要课题。

要了解操作系统是如何划分和调度进程的。进程是计算机中正在执行的程序实例,操作系统通过进程控制块(PCB)来维护进程的状态信息。每个进程都被分配特定的资源,包括内存、CPU时间片等。当多个进程并发执行时,操作系统需要合理调度,确保系统资源得到高效利用。这就要求我们对后台程序的执行优先级进行合理设置,不同类型的任务应基于不同的优先级进行调度。
监控后台程序的性能也是进程管理的重要组成部分。大多数操作系统提供任务管理器或监控工具,用于查看当前运行的进程、CPU和内存的使用情况。及时识别资源占用过高的后台程序,可以帮助用户优化系统性能。如果某个程序在长时间内处于高资源占用状态,可以选择结束该进程,防止其影响其他程序的正常运行。
接下来,优化后台程序的运行方式也是提升系统效率的一个有效手段。许多应用程序允许用户自定义启动选项和运行频率。通过调整这些设置,可以在满足工作需求的减少对系统资源的占用。例如,可以将不常用的程序设置为手动启动,而不是在系统启动时自动加载。这样不仅能加快系统启动速度,还能留出更多资源供其他应用使用。
定期进行系统维护和软件更新也是确保后台程序高效运行的关键。一些新版本的软件在性能上会进行优化,修复已知的bug。升级操作系统本身也可能带来更好的进程调度算法和资源管理策略。保持软件的最新状态,可以在根本上改善后台程序的运行效率。
通过合理操作和管理后台程序,不仅能够提升系统整体性能,还能给用户带来更流畅的操作体验。掌握这些进程管理的基本知识,将使我们在使用计算机时更游刃有余。
